Original political poster, Down with American imperialism, down with Soviet revisionism, People's Republic of China, 1967. The design depicts Chairman Mao as the centre of the sun, above a group of international communist fighters. By this date, Mao and the Chinese leadership had become increasingly dissatisfied with what they viewed as the Soviet Union's divergence from the correct interpretation of Marxism-Leninism. This view, along with anti-imperialist slogans directed at America, is a common theme of posters produced during the height of the Cultural Revolution.
